In a world where data drives every decision, the ability to extract meaningful insights from complex datasets has become paramount. Enter LLM-powered SQL agents—the groundbreaking integration of Large Language Models (LLMs) with SQL automation. These agents are revolutionizing data analysis across industries by combining natural language understanding with precise database querying.

From healthcare to finance, and even legal analytics, SQL agents are unlocking new levels of efficiency and insight, enabling organizations to make data-driven decisions faster and with greater accuracy. In this article, we’ll explore the capabilities, challenges, and future potential of these transformative tools.

The Rise of LLM-Powered SQL Agents

At their core, SQL agents powered by LLMs transcend traditional data analysis. These agents don’t just translate natural language inputs into SQL queries; they serve as intelligent intermediaries, capable of understanding context, recognizing patterns, and providing actionable insights.

Unlike conventional data analysts, SQL agents can:

  • Perform semantic grouping to identify relationships within datasets.
  • Detect patterns across multiple dimensions like time, geography, and demographics.
  • Handle ambiguous queries with industry-specific terminology.

By bridging the gap between human intent and computational precision, SQL agents are revolutionizing how we interact with structured data.

Real-World Applications Across Industries

1. Healthcare Analytics

In healthcare, the ability to analyze complex patient datasets is critical. SQL agents powered by LLMs enable:

  • Real-time analysis of patient care patterns and outcomes.
  • Instant insights into drug interaction patterns.
  • The generation of statistical significance reports for clinical trials.

Example: "Patients over 65 show a 40% better response to Drug A when combined with vitamin D supplementation."

2. Financial Analytics

In finance, SQL agents simplify market analysis by:

  • Identifying trends with semantic understanding.
  • Grouping financial instruments contextually.
  • Offering natural language summaries of market behaviors.

Example: "Companies with high exposure to semiconductor supply chains are showing increased volatility."

3. Legal Analytics

In the legal domain, SQL agents enhance research efficiency by:

  • Analyzing case precedents across jurisdictions.
  • Predicting settlement outcomes based on historical data.
  • Aggregating trends by judge, case type, or jurisdiction.

Example: "Patent infringement cases in the technology sector demonstrate stronger outcomes with preliminary injunction filings."

Strengths of LLM-Powered SQL Agents

Integrating LLMs with SQL agents enables these systems to handle ambiguity and complexity in natural language queries. LLMs excel in semantic understanding and pattern recognition, allowing SQL agents to group related concepts intelligently and generate meaningful insights faster than traditional approaches. Additional strengths include:

  • Automated Insights: Extract narratives and hypotheses from raw data without requiring human intervention.
  • Cross-Domain Integration: Generate multi-domain insights by linking data across industries, which is particularly relevant for large organizations with diverse datasets.
  • Real-Time Processing: Enable dynamic adjustments and instant feedback for continuous data flow.

These capabilities make LLM-powered SQL agents a valuable tool for organizations seeking efficiency and innovation in their data analytics.

The strength of LLM-powered SQL agents lies in their ability to continuously learn and adapt through AI-driven improvements. Their integration with business intelligence platforms and cloud-based data warehouses ensures seamless scalability and enhanced operational efficiency. This makes them ideal for organizations looking to adopt AI-driven data solutions to stay ahead in their respective industries.

Challenges in Implementing SQL Agents

1. Handling Natural Language Ambiguity

SQL agents must navigate queries like, “List all patients with RA,” which could mean:

  • Rheumatoid Arthritis
  • Refractory Anemia
  • Right Atrium

Overcoming such ambiguity requires terminology standardization and robust entity recognition.

2. Managing Database Complexity

Modern databases, especially in enterprises, feature hundreds of interconnected tables with varying schemas and naming conventions. SQL agents must adapt to:

  • Non-intuitive column names (e.g., "pt_dem_tbl").
  • Diverse data formats (e.g., MM/DD/YYYY vs. ISO date).

3. Ensuring Query Efficiency

Handling multi-table joins, nested subqueries, and aggregation operations can strain SQL agents. Strategies like denormalization and progressive filtering are critical for maintaining performance.

Optimizing SQL Agents for Success

Feedback-Driven Improvement

  • Expert Feedback: Experts test the system with real-world queries to highlight weaknesses.
  • Synthetic Data Generation: Expanding datasets with synthetic queries improves adaptability and robustness.

Database Optimization

  • Simplify schemas through denormalization.
  • Use pre-aggregated views for common queries to reduce computational load.
  • Implement caching to enhance query speed.

Entity-Aware Query Handling

By building indices on normalized entities, SQL agents can:

  • Improve recall for high-cardinality datasets.
  • Handle ambiguous inputs more effectively.

The Role of Feedback Loops

A key feature of SQL agents is their iterative improvement through feedback loops. Feedback from symbolic components, like SQL interpreters, provides explicit insights into what went wrong, enabling quick iterations and improvements. By collecting feedback from both real and synthetically generated queries, organizations can refine their SQL agents to handle edge cases and bottlenecks more effectively.

Feedback loops ensure continuous improvement, a crucial element in deploying AI-driven solutions for mission-critical applications. By integrating automated error tracking and self-healing mechanisms, organizations can maintain high reliability and accuracy in SQL agent outputs.

Real-World Example: Healthcare Analytics

A project implemented for a biotech client demonstrated the power of SQL agents in healthcare analytics. The SQL agent analyzed a corpus of clinical trials, enabling investors to:

  • Identify active components and mechanisms of action.
  • Spot competitive trends in the market.
  • Perform semantic grouping of clinical trials for a clearer competitive landscape.

The system enabled the client to make data-driven decisions quickly by providing actionable insights and reducing the time needed for manual data analysis.

Similar applications are being seen in pharmaceuticals, where SQL agents help researchers identify drug efficacy trends and streamline the process of regulatory approval by extracting critical insights from clinical data repositories.

Future Directions

The future of LLM-powered SQL agents lies in autonomous optimization. These agents could eventually act as data engineers, reorganizing schemas, creating views, and optimizing data structures based on usage patterns. This evolution will further enhance efficiency and adaptability, making SQL agents indispensable tools for data-driven organizations.

Future advancements may include integrating SQL agents with augmented analytics platforms, enabling predictive and prescriptive insights. By combining the power of LLMs with visualization tools, organizations can make data more actionable and accessible to non-technical stakeholders.

As these systems evolve, exciting opportunities emerge:

  1. Automated Schema Optimization: SQL agents that dynamically adapt to changing query patterns.
  2. Advanced Feedback Mechanisms: Continuous learning loops for ongoing performance refinement.
  3. Cross-Domain Integration: Unlocking holistic insights by combining unrelated datasets.

Key Takeaways

The session concluded with practical steps organizations can take to optimize their data for LLM-driven SQL agents:

  1. Standardize Terminology: Build taxonomies and normalize entities to improve recall.
  2. Optimize Data Structures: Use denormalization and pre-aggregated views to simplify database navigation.
  3. Leverage Query Templates: Analyze historical data to create reusable templates for common queries.

Reducing degrees of freedom in data structures and interactions is essential for improving performance and minimizing errors.

Organizations should also consider leveraging cloud-native solutions and adopting data cataloging tools to ensure consistent and scalable implementations of SQL agents powered by LLMs.

Conclusion

LLM-powered SQL agents are paving the way for a new era in data analysis. By addressing challenges like natural language ambiguity, database complexity, and query generation bottlenecks, these tools empower organizations to unlock the full potential of their data. Whether in healthcare, finance, or legal analytics, SQL agents are transforming how we derive insights and make decisions. As technology advances, the possibilities for these agents will only expand, making them indispensable for data-driven success.

Stay in the know!

From success stories to industrytrends, our experience keep you informed and inspired.
Get a Free Consultation